Why Sleeping With Fairy Lights On May Disrupt Sleep Quality
Some people love to fall asleep with pretty lights on, like fairy lights, because they make the room feel cosy and calm.
But sleep doctors say it is not a good idea to sleep with those lights on.
Even soft, dim lights can confuse our brains and bodies.
Our bodies may think it is still daytime when there is light in the room.
That can make it harder to get deep and restful sleep.
Deep sleep is important because it helps us feel fresh and healthy.
One expert, Dr Pooja T, a lung doctor at a hospital in Bangalore, says even dim decorative lighting can affect how deeply we sleep.
So it is better to turn off the pretty lights before going to bed.
